The Life Design Framework in The Life Architect

Most people are building a life they did not deliberately choose. They make decisions based on immediate demands. Career demands, financial obligations, relationships, and outside expectations quietly determine their path.

From the outside, everything may appear successful. But privately, many people ask a deeper question: Where is all of this leading?

This is why the phrase "how to design your life intentionally" resonates with so many people. They are not searching for another productivity hack. They are looking for a framework that makes sense of their choices.

The prevailing belief is that if you work hard enough, fulfillment will follow. But success and alignment are not the same thing. You can build something impressive that does not feel like home.

This is the foundational insight in The Life Architect. In [The Life Architect](https://www.amazon.com/LIFE-ARCHITECT-People-Structure-Before-ebook/dp/B0H15KLRDJ?utm_source=chatgpt.com), Arnaldo (Arns) Jara presents life as an architectural system rather than a series of isolated choices.

Architects do not focus first on appearances. They begin with foundations, load-bearing elements, and long-term integrity. The same discipline applies to relationships, careers, and goals.

Many people attempt to fix their lives by changing isolated behaviors. They switch jobs, move cities, or adopt new routines. But if the underlying design remains flawed, the same problems return.

One of the most important questions in The Life Architect is simple: What is the structure my choices are creating?

This question changes how decisions are made. Instead of reacting to immediate pressure, you evaluate structural impact.

Practical Insight #1: Foundations Before Expansion. Growth requires a stable foundation. The same rule governs long-term success.

Practical Insight #2: Logical Steps Do Not Always Create Meaningful Outcomes. Many people made sensible decisions that no longer fit their values.

Practical Insight #3: Design Beats Intensity. Energy changes, but structure endures.

Practical Insight #4: Your Life Works as a System. No major decision exists in isolation.

Practical Insight #5: Timing Is Structural. The wrong order can undermine otherwise good decisions.
